NRG Energy, Inc., together with its subsidiaries, operates as an energy and home services company in the United States and Canada. It operates through the Texas, East, West/Other, Vivint Smart Home, and Corporate Activities segments. The company offers retail electricity, energy management, demand response and virtual power plant programs, carbon offsets, smart home security, and automation services. It also offers system power, distributed and backup generation, energy storage, energy management, renewable and low-carbon products, and carbon management solutions for large business and commercial customers; a cloud-based home platform, including hardware, software, sales, installation, customer service, technical support, and professional monitoring solutions; and generation portfolio includes fossil fuel and renewable generation assets diversified by fuel type and dispatch level, with ongoing development of new natural gas and renewable projects. In addition, the company trades in power, natural gas, and related products; environmental products; weather products; and financial products, including forwards, futures, options, and swaps. It offers its products and services under the NRG, Reliant, Direct Energy, Green Mountain Energy, and Vivint. It serves residential, commercial, government, industrial, data center, and wholesale customers. NRG Energy, Inc. was founded in 1989 and is headquartered in Houston, Texas.
